【AttributeError: 'tensor' Object Has No Attribute 'Numpy'】
在Python中,当遇到AttributeError: 'tensor' Object Has No Attribute 'Numpy'时,通常会提示你检查代码中是否存在对numpy
属性的访问错误。然而,这种错误可能并不总是由于访问错误导致的。在这篇文章中,我们将深入探讨在Python中遇到该错误时可能存在的潜在问题。
问题1:未安装相关库
当在Python中运行带有numpy
属性的代码时,Python会默认检查该库是否安装。如果在运行时库中安装了numpy
库,则运行时错误通常不会出现。但是,在某些情况下,你可能需要重新安装numpy
库。
问题2:错误的Numpy版本
如果你的numpy
版本与你在Python中使用的版本不兼容,则可能会出现AttributeError。在这种情况下,你需要更新你的numpy
版本,或者确认你的代码中使用的numpy
库版本是正确的。
问题3:代码结构错误
在某些情况下,AttributeError: 'tensor' Object Has No Attribute 'Numpy'可能是由于代码结构错误导致的。例如,如果你的代码中存在命名冲突,或者在导入numpy
库时使用了错误的语法,则可能会出现此类错误。在这种情况下,你需要仔细检查代码结构,并确保代码是按照预期运行的。
解决方法
- 确认你的
numpy
版本是否正确安装。 - 检查代码中是否存在命名冲突或者错误的导入语法。
- 如果以上两种情况都没有发现,请尝试使用
pip
工具重新安装numpy
库,或者联系开发人员以获取帮助。
结论
在Python中,AttributeError: 'tensor' Object Has No Attribute 'Numpy'可能是由于多种原因导致的。通过仔细检查代码,并确保numpy
版本正确安装,可以有效避免此类错误的发生。如果你仍然无法解决该问题,请尝试联系开发人员以获取帮助。
点击查看更多内容
为 TA 点赞
评论
共同学习,写下你的评论
评论加载中...
作者其他优质文章
正在加载中
感谢您的支持,我会继续努力的~
扫码打赏,你说多少就多少
赞赏金额会直接到老师账户
支付方式
打开微信扫一扫,即可进行扫码打赏哦